共 3 篇文章
标签:租用香港服务器运营网站如何确保数据安全
在HTML中,外边距(Margin)是元素与其周围空间之间的距离,它可以使元素与其他元素保持一定的间距,从而使页面布局更加美观和易于阅读,外边距的计算涉及到许多方面,包括内边距、边框、外边距之间的关系,以及如何通过CSS来设置和管理外边距,本文将详细介绍HTML外边距的计算方法,并提供一些实用的技术教学。,1、外边距的基本概念,在HTML中,每个元素都有四个外边距:上、右、下和左,这四个外边距可以分别通过CSS属性 margintop、 marginright、 marginbottom和 marginleft来设置,外边距的默认值通常是0,但可以根据需要进行调整。,2、外边距的合并,当两个垂直外边距相遇时,它们会合并成一个外边距,这意味着,如果一个元素的上外边距与另一个元素的下外边距相等,那么它们的外边距将叠加在一起,形成一个更大的外边距,这个过程称为外边距合并。,外边距合并可以通过以下CSS规则避免:,为了避免上下外边距合并,可以为其中一个元素添加 overflow: hidden;属性:,3、外边距与内边距的关系,内边距(Padding)是元素内容与其边框之间的距离,外边距与内边距之间存在一定的关系,当一个元素的内边距、边框和外边距都设置为正值时,元素的实际宽度会等于其宽度属性加上左右外边距、左右内边距和左右边框的宽度之和,反之,当这些值都设置为负值时,元素的实际宽度会减小。,假设一个元素的宽度为100px,左右内边距为10px,左右边框为5px,左右外边距为15px,那么元素的实际宽度为:,实际宽度 = 100px + 15px + 15px = 130px,4、外边距的百分比计算,CSS中的外边距可以使用百分比来设置,这使得我们可以更容易地实现响应式布局,百分比外边距是基于父元素的宽度来计算的,如果一个元素的左外边距设置为20%,那么它的实际宽度将是其父元素宽度的20%。,5、外边距的简写属性,CSS3引入了一个简写属性 margin,用于一次性设置所有四个外边距属性。,这个简写属性的值按照上、右、下、左的顺序依次设置,如果只提供一个值,它将被应用于所有四个方向:,6、外边距的溢出行为,当一个元素的外边距溢出其父元素的边界时,它的行为取决于父元素的 overflow属性,如果 overflow属性设置为 visible(默认值),那么溢出的外边距将继续向外延伸,直到遇到另一个具有较低堆叠顺序的元素,如果 overflow属性设置为 hidden或 auto,那么溢出的外边距将被裁剪掉。,7、外边距的实用技巧,使用负外边距可以实现元素的重叠效果,将一个元素的下外边距设置为负值,可以使它具有“悬浮”在另一个元素上方的效果。,使用透明边框和负外边距可以实现类似卡片的效果,将一个元素的边框设置为透明,并将左右外边距设置为负值,可以使它具有卡片式的外观。,使用百分比外边距可以实现响应式布局,将一个元素的左右外边距设置为50%,可以使它在屏幕宽度变化时始终保持水平居中。,HTML外边距是一种非常重要的布局工具,可以帮助我们创建出美观、易于阅读的页面,通过了解外边距的基本概念、计算方法和实用技巧,我们可以更好地掌握HTML和CSS,从而成为一名优秀的前端开发人员。,,div { margintop: 1px; marginbottom: 1px; },div { overflow: hidden; margintop: 1px; },div { margin: 10px 20px 30px 40px; },div { margin: 10px; },
HTML的表格可以通过使用 <table>、 <tr>、 <td>等标签来创建,要绑定数据类型,可以使用JavaScript或者后端语言(如PHP、Python等)来动态生成表格内容,以下是一个简单的示例:,1、创建一个HTML文件,添加一个 <table>元素,并为其添加一个 id属性,以便稍后使用JavaScript或后端语言获取该元素。,2、接下来,创建一个JavaScript文件(script.js),并编写代码以动态生成表格内容,在这个示例中,我们将使用JavaScript数组来存储数据,并将其绑定到表格中。,3、将JavaScript文件链接到HTML文件中,以便在浏览器中运行代码,在上面的HTML文件中,我们已经添加了一个 <script>标签来引用JavaScript文件,现在,当你打开HTML文件时,表格将根据数据数组的内容自动生成。, ,<!DOCTYPE html> <html lang=”en”> <head> <meta charset=”UTF8″> <meta name=”viewport” content=”width=devicewidth, initialscale=1.0″> <title>HTML Table 绑定数据类型示例</title> </head> <body> <table id=”myTable”> <!表格内容将通过JavaScript或后端语言动态生成 > </table> <script src=”script.js”></script> </body> </html>,// 定义数据数组 const data = [ { name: ‘张三’, age: 25, gender: ‘男’ }, { name: ‘李四’, age: 30, gender: ‘女’ }, { name: ‘王五’, age: 28, gender: ‘男’ } ]; // 获取表格元素 const table = document.getElementById(‘myTable’); // 遍历数据数组,为每个对象创建一个表格行(tr)和单元格(td) data.forEach(item => { const row = document.createElement(‘tr’); for (const key in item) { const cell = document.createElement(‘td’); cell.textContent = item[key]; // 将数据绑定到单元格中 row.appendChild(cell); // 将单元格添加到行中 } table.appendChild(row); // 将行添加到表格中 });,
香港服务器与国内服务器在很多方面都有雷同之处,但也存在一些显著的不同,这些差异主要体现在地理位置、网络环境、政策规定和价格等方面,下面我们将详细介绍这四个方面的内容。,香港服务器位于中国香港特别行政区,而国内服务器则分布在中国大陆的各个地区,由于地理位置的差异,香港服务器相对于国内服务器来说,距离国际互联网的主要节点更近,因此在访问国际网站时,香港服务器的延迟更低,速度更快。, ,1、国际出口带宽:香港服务器的国际出口带宽相对较大,因此在访问国际网站时,速度更快,而国内服务器的国际出口带宽受到一定的限制,访问国际网站的速度相对较慢。,2、IP地址:香港服务器的IP地址属于国际IP地址,而国内服务器的IP地址属于国内IP地址,国际IP地址在全球范围内具有更好的可识别性,有利于提高网站的知名度和访问量。,3、网络质量:香港作为国际金融中心,其网络基础设施非常完善,网络质量较高,而国内不同地区的网络质量存在差异,部分地区的网络质量可能不如香港。,1、内容审查:香港特别行政区政府对互联网内容的管理相对宽松,言论自由度较高,而中国大陆实行严格的网络审查制度,对涉及政治、宗教、色情等敏感内容的网站进行严格审查和封禁。,2、数据安全:香港特别行政区政府对数据安全和个人隐私的保护力度较大,相关法律法规较为完善,而中国大陆的数据安全和个人隐私保护相对较弱,相关法律法规尚不完善。,3、业务许可:香港服务器提供商需要获得香港政府颁发的相关许可证才能合法经营,而国内服务器提供商则需要获得国家相关部门颁发的许可证。, ,香港服务器的价格相对较高,主要原因在于香港的人力成本、房租成本和运营成本都较高,而国内服务器的价格相对较低,但不同地区的价格也存在一定的差异,总体来说,香港服务器的价格高于国内服务器。,相关问题与解答:,1、香港服务器和国内服务器在访问速度上有什么区别?,答:由于地理位置的差异,香港服务器相对于国内服务器来说,距离国际互联网的主要节点更近,因此在访问国际网站时,香港服务器的延迟更低,速度更快,而国内服务器的国际出口带宽受到一定的限制,访问国际网站的速度相对较慢。,2、香港服务器和国内服务器在内容审查方面有什么不同?,答:香港特别行政区政府对互联网内容的管理相对宽松,言论自由度较高,而中国大陆实行严格的网络审查制度,对涉及政治、宗教、色情等敏感内容的网站进行严格审查和封禁。, ,3、为什么香港服务器的价格比国内服务器高?,答:香港的人力成本、房租成本和运营成本都较高,这些因素导致了香港服务器的价格相对较高,而国内服务器的价格相对较低,但不同地区的价格也存在一定的差异。,4、如何选择适合自己需求的服务器?,答:在选择服务器时,应根据自己的需求来考虑,如果主要面向国际用户,需要访问国际网站,可以选择香港服务器;如果主要面向国内用户,可以考虑选择国内服务器,还需要考虑价格、网络质量和服务等因素。,香港服务器与国内服务器均提供网站托管服务,但区别在于香港服务器无需备案,访问速度更快。